High Performance Thin Layer Chromatographic Identification
Narrow-leaf Echinacea (root) (Echinacea angustifolia) Lane Assignments Lanes, from left to right (Track, Volume, Sample):
Reference materials used here have been authenticated by macroscopic, microscopic &/or TLC studies according to the reference source cited below held at Alkemists Laboratories, Costa Mesa, CA. Stationary Phase Silica gel 60, F254, 10 x 10 cm HPTLC plates Mobile Phase ethyl acetate: MEK methylethyl ketone: HCOOH: H2O [5/3/1/1] Sample Preparation Method 0.3 g + 3 ml CH3OH sonicate 10 min NO HEAT Detection Method Natural Product Reagent + PEG -> UV 365 nm Reference see American Herbal Pharmacopoeia & Therapeutic Compendium
